That really is how I feel about this set. Ages ago, and I do mean ages ago I used to work in a wire harness shop. I ran hundreds of miles of wire working for that place. I also developed carpal tunnel syndrome. If you do not know what it is, you are lucky. So anyway ever since then whenever I do a lot of computer work I get sore and inflamed wrists that just ache. 



Handy dandy little devices such as the keyboard wrist rest is supposed to help eliminate this issue. It is supposed to put your wrists at a supported angle.  So again.. do I like it? Yeah I kind of do. I do not
have a mouse. So I use that mouse pad and support to rest on when I am scrolling thru web pages on the touch screen. As for the long strip that is supposed to go on the computer, not so much. It seems a little soft/empty to me. Like it needs to be filled more. That would be a good way to describe it. So in that aspect I think it is just ok.
